    Default itunes wont load on vista laptop

    hi,can someone please help.
    ive been using my iphone and itunes with xp untill recently with ok results.its too long a story to go into but i have had to start using vista.but everytime i click the itunes icon it starts to install itunes even though ive been through this process.then tells me to restart my computer to finnish install.
    then when i hit the icon once again it starts to install.
    this is driving me crazy.
    any ideas.
    cheers,neil

    So you did an upgrade to windows vista from xpo and are trying to run the xp install? This won;t work, you need to uninstall then reinstall vista. I hate windows upgrades... it is cleaner to just install a fresh copy of Vista. Also make sure you download the right version of itunes as there is a version for 64 bit vista as well.
